Melancholia

Melancholia, directed by Lars von Trier, depicts a scenario where a planet’s impending collision with Earth coincides with a marriage. The film centers on two sisters grappling with existential dread amidst the catastrophic event, marking the second installment of von Trier's Depression Trilogy.

Alphaville

Alphaville, directed by Jean-Luc Godard, presents a dystopian science fiction narrative utilizing real locations in Paris as its setting. The film blends elements of noir with a futuristic cityscape represented through modernist architecture and features characters referencing 20th-century events like the Guadalcanal campaign.
